Document.ActiveWritingStyle Свойство (2007 System)
Обновлен: Июль 2008
Возвращает стиль записи для указанного языка документа.
Пространство имен: Microsoft.Office.Tools.Word
Сборка: Microsoft.Office.Tools.Word.v9.0 (в Microsoft.Office.Tools.Word.v9.0.dll)
Синтаксис
'Декларация
<BrowsableAttribute(False)> _
Public Overridable ReadOnly Property ActiveWritingStyle As Document..::._ActiveWritingStyleType
'Применение
Dim instance As Document
Dim value As Document..::._ActiveWritingStyleType
value = instance.ActiveWritingStyle
[BrowsableAttribute(false)]
public virtual Document..::._ActiveWritingStyleType ActiveWritingStyle { get; }
Значение свойства
Тип: Microsoft.Office.Tools.Word.Document._ActiveWritingStyleType
Строка, определяющая стиль записи для указанного языка документа.
Заметки
Свойство ActiveWritingStyle должно использоваться с указанным ниже параметром.
Параметр |
Описание |
---|---|
LanguageID |
Одно из значений WdLanguageID, определяющих язык для установки стиля записи в указанный документ. |
При попытке использования свойства ActiveWritingStyle без указания параметра свойство ActiveWritingStyle возвратит объект Document._ActiveWritingStyleType, являющийся частью инфраструктуры Visual Studio Tools for Office и не предназначенный для непосредственного использования в коде.
Свойство WritingStyleList возвращает массив имен доступных стилей записи.
Примеры
В приведенном ниже примере кода выводится стиль записи текста в текущем выделенном фрагменте.
Эта версия предназначена для настройки уровня документа.
Private Sub DocumentActiveWritingStyle()
MessageBox.Show(Me.ActiveWritingStyle(Me.Application.Selection. _
LanguageID).ToString())
End Sub
private void DocumentActiveWritingStyle()
{
MessageBox.Show(this.ActiveWritingStyle[this.Application.
Selection.LanguageID].ToString());
}
Эта версия предназначена для надстройки уровня приложения.
Private Sub DocumentActiveWritingStyle()
Dim vstoDoc As Document = Me.Application.ActiveDocument.GetVstoObject()
System.Windows.Forms.MessageBox.Show(vstoDoc.ActiveWritingStyle( _
vstoDoc.Application.Selection. _
LanguageID).ToString())
End Sub
private void DocumentActiveWritingStyle()
{
Document vstoDoc = this.Application.ActiveDocument.GetVstoObject();
System.Windows.Forms.MessageBox.Show(vstoDoc.ActiveWritingStyle[vstoDoc.Application.
Selection.LanguageID].ToString());
}
Разрешения
- Полное доверие для непосредственно вызывающего метода. Этот член не может быть использован частично доверенным кодом. Дополнительные сведения см. в разделе Использование библиотек из не вполне надежного кода.
См. также
Ссылки
Microsoft.Office.Tools.Word - пространство имен
Журнал изменений
Дата |
Журнал событий |
Причина |
---|---|---|
Июль 2008 |
Добавлена версия кода для надстройки уровня приложения. |
Изменение функции SP1. |